Abstract
--This study is a part of comprehensive program wherein experimental investigations have been carried out to evaluate the effect of partial replacement of coarse aggregate by Construction and Demolition(C&D) Waste on compressive strength, tensile strength and workability of RAC (Recycled Aggregate Concrete). The main objective of this investigation is to find out up to what percentage the Natural Coarse Aggregate (NCA) can be replaced by Recycled Coarse Aggregate in the concrete mix for an equivalent application or purpose. So in this study we have taken the demolished concrete aggregate 10%, 20%, and 30% by weight of the conventional coarse aggregate and the concrete cubes were casted by Recycled Aggregate Concrete. Then further tests conducted such as Workability test, Compressive strength test and Split tensile test for that DAC at the end of 7 days and 28 days curing period. For the strength characteristics, the result showed a gradual decrease in Workability, Compressive strength and Split tensile strength as the percentage of recycled aggregate is increased.
